- Sheer, but Make It Chic
Mesh is like that friend who doesn’t say much but always steals the spotlight. Whether it’s a mesh crop layered over a bandeau or a sheer long-sleeve under a leather vest, the key is balance. You’re not trying to show everything, just enough to keep ‘em guessing.
- It’s All About the Underscore
Mesh is only as cool as what you wear under (or over) it. Tank tops, bralettes, bodysuits, this is your layering playground. For more edge, pair with a neon sports bra. For subtle sophistication, go all black or neutral underneath. Either way, make that base layer count. It’s doing half the heavy lifting.
- No Gym Energy Allowed
Leave the performance mesh where it belongs, at the treadmill. For streetwear, go for structured mesh, or mesh blended with cotton or organza. Think statement pieces, not sweat-ready. And if it feels like it should come with a matching water bottle? Hard pass.
- Cover Up to Stand Out
Ironically, the more you cover, the more mesh pops. Full-sleeve mesh top with high-waisted trousers. A mesh dress over bike shorts and a boxy tee. The drama isn’t in how much skin you show, it’s in how well you frame it. Let contrast do the talking.
- Say No to “Safe” Shoes
Loafers? Flats? Not today. Mesh craves footwear with backbone. We’re talking combat boots, exaggerated soles, futuristic sneakers, or even mesh-detailed heels if you’re feeling wild. The goal? Let the mesh lead and the shoes follow with attitude.
- Stack Up the Statement Pieces
Minimalism and mesh rarely mix. When the base is bare, accessories should do the dressing. Bold chains, edgy cuffs, visor caps, exaggerated earrings, go big or go home. Think of mesh as your style canvas. You’re the artist. Now paint.
- It’s Not Just for Tops
Yes, mesh tops are great, but don’t sleep on mesh panels in pants, sheer skirts over shorts, or mesh gloves that bring the drama. Even bags and outerwear with mesh cutouts have entered the scene. There’s no one way to wear mesh. That’s what makes it cool.
